    Xbox have previously been fairly strong on parity between X and S, and were strong on that messaging when selling the S. They were clear there would be visual differences - resolution, FPS, Ray Tracing being the tradeoffs for the lower cost entry point. Spencer quoted yesterday (or day before) saying differences between the consoles aren't new, I think in either reaction to this news or to get out ahead of it - and that first party titles have had differences, but he used Ray Tracing as the example. To me, ray tracing and split screen are completely different types of feature. One is gameplay, and it is far harder to accept a gameplay feature difference, given their previous messaging.

    Don't get me wrong, I think this is the right call. It would be insane for Xbox to miss out on Baldurs Gate 3 on both consoles cause SplitScreen is proving difficult on the S. If given the choice I would assume 100% of S players would say 'give us the option to play BG3 without split screen rather than not at all', but where do Xbox draw the line now? What are acceptable features to drop?

    Yeah it's unfortunate but somewhat inevitable that disparity in features beyond resolution/framerate are required between the Series S and X. The Series S is a great machine by all accounts, but it was always going to become the bottleneck for this gen, and there have been previous reports of developers not being happy with the Series S and trying to get that uniformity between it and the Series X.

    So it does become the question of what do or don't Xbox allow? They seem to have been pushing for that parity in BG3 until the game suddenly became a huge success and they realised they needed to get it out on Xbox as quickly as possible.
